She is with another
They touch
He holds her
And yet they never meet.
Where did the old love go?
Draining down, out of a
Soul as black as tar
Dripping faucet tears
Confusion, indecision
The feelings, long repressed
Threaten to start anew
He kisses her
She holds him back
Not once has he seen her.
This is not love
How can it be
If they have never met?
The aching does not stop
When first they touch
Within an act of lust
Her chill white skin
Against his hand
It trembles in the dark
Yet all is well
In both their lives
Until that day.
She says one word in fear
And the ceiling crumbles
The walls cave in
White plaster dust
Strangling her
Ivory over ivory over
Red velvet petals
Of pure pain
Alone again
She cries, she prays
As lovers do;
She prays that he cries too.


-Liu Nakanishi
